The Town Council for the Town of Trophy Club met in Regular Session
on Monday, October 24th, 1988 at 7:00 P.M. The meeting was held at
the Municipal Utility District Building,100 Municipal Drive, Trophy
Club, Texas. The meeting was held within the Town boundaries and was
open to the Public.

TOWN COUNCIL TO CONSIDER A CONTRACT WITH DENTON COUNTY CONCERNING
LAW ENFORCEMENT FOR THE NEXT FISCAL YEAR
Mayor Pro Tem Vance made a motion to approve the contract with Denton
County Sheriff Dept. and include in the contract the Town Secretary
as an alternate to administer the contract in the absence of the
Town Marshal. Council Member Foley seconded the motion. Motion failed
with 2 votes in favor of the motion and 3 votes opposed to the motion.
Council Members Doran, Martignago and Hallgren voted against the motion.

Council Member Hallgren made a motion to approve the contract with
Denton County Sheriff Department as written and to include a letter
specifying the Town Secretary as an alternate person to administer
the contract. Council Member Martignago seconded the motion. Motion
carried unanimously.

CONSIDERATION OF ORDINANCE: SECOND READING
TOWN COUNCIL TO CONSIDER AMENDING ORDINANCE NO. 86-09 CONCERNING
OVERNIGHT PARKING
Council Member Foley made a motion to table consideration of the
Ordinance. Council Member Martignago seconded the motion. Motion
failed with a vote of 2/3.
Mayor Pro Tem Vance made a motion to accept the Ordinance as modified.
Council Member Martignago seconded the motion. Motion carried
unanimously.
TOWN COUNCIL TO CONSIDER AMENDING ORDINANCE NO. 87-13 CONCERNING
NO PARKING ON CERTAIN STREETS
Mayor Pro Tem Vance made a motion to accept the Ordinance as modified.
Council Member Martignago seconded the motion. Motion carried
unanimously.
